Casement windows that open in the wrong direction will greatly affect your interior and exterior property aesthetics. Here are five tips to help you find the best choice.
Tip #1: Understanding Left and Right-Hand Cranks
Right-hand crank casement windows are installed with the opening located on the right side. The right-hand crank window is opened by turning the crank on the right side of the window counterclockwise towards a closed position. Alternatively, left-hand crank windows have the same principle but on opposing sides.
A right-hand crank window is suitable for homeowners with dominant right hands because it encourages a natural window opening movement. The alternative left-hand crank is perfect for left-handed homeowners. With these factors in mind, crank orientation is crucial in choosing casement window direction.
Tip #2: Open Toward The Center
Architects often install casement windows with their hinges facing the room’s center. This creates a much more open appeal than the “limited” aesthetic of hinges that face the walls. In addition, this orientation allows the windows to provide more natural light and ventilation.
Tip #3: Maximize Ventilation
In a kitchen or other room, you can maximize the ventilation capability of casement windows by opening them in opposite directions. Doing so creates two air streams that flow in opposite directions, which helps reduce the amount of heat and humidity retained inside.
Tip #4: Paired Aesthetics
Casement windows can look like small French doors that look elegant when they open together. Considering their appeal, you should use two casement windows installed together if they are on the same wall.
